RBI Grade B Eligible Criteria:

Citizenship & Nationality

• Must be a citizen of India

• Must be a subject of Nepal

• Must be a subject of Bhutan

• Must be a Tibetan Refugee who came to India before 1st January 1962 and has the intention of settling permanently in India.

• A person of Indian origin migrated from Pakistan, Burma, Sri Lanka, East African countries of Kenya, the United Republic of Tanzania (formerly Tanganyika and Zanzibar), Uganda, Zambia, Malawi, Zaire, Ethiopia and Vietnam with the intention of permanently settling in India.

Education Qualification –

PostsMinimum Educational Qualifications 
Officers in Grade ‘B’ (DR) – (General)• Graduation in any discipline /Equivalent technical or professional qualification with minimum 60% marks (50% for SC/ST/PwBD applicants) or Post-Graduation / Equivalent technical qualification with minimum 55% marks (pass marks for SC/ST/PwBD applicants) in aggregate of all semesters / years.
Note:
• Any such full-time course from a recognised University / Institute that is taken after Class XIIth and is at least of 3 years’ duration/ candidates possessing professional and technical qualifications which are recognised by the Government as equivalent to professional and technical graduation will be eligible for admission to the examination.
• Candidates who have passed the Final Examination for Membership of the Institute of Chartered Accountants of India may also apply for the post.
OR
• Any such full-time course from a recognised University / Institute that is taken after graduation and is at least of 2 years’ duration / recognised by the Government as equivalent to post graduation will be eligible for admission to the examination.
Officers in Grade ‘B’ (DR) – DEPR• Essential: 
(a.) A Master’s Degree in Economics / Econometrics / Quantitative Economics / Mathematical Economics / Integrated Economics Course/ Finance, with a minimum of 55% marks or an equivalent grade in aggregate of all semesters /years from a recognised Indian or Foreign University /Institute.OR
(b.) PGDM/ MBA Finance with a minimum of 55% marks or an equivalent grade in aggregate of all semesters /years from a recognised Indian or Foreign University /Institute.
OR
(c.) Master’s Degree in Economics in any of the sub-categories of economics i.e. agricultural/ business/ developmental/ applied, etc., with a minimum of 55% marks or an equivalent grade in aggregate of all semesters /years from a recognised Indian or Foreign University /Instituted.
(d) Candidates having Master’s Degree with Research/Teaching experience at a recognized Indian/Foreign University/ Institute will be eligible for relaxation in upper age limit to the extent of number of years of such experience subject to a maximum of three years. For experience, probationary period will not be reckoned.
Officers in Grade ‘B’ (DR) – DSIMEssential:
(a.) A Master’s Degree in Statistics/ Mathematical Statistics/ Mathematical Economics/ Econometrics/ Statistics & Informatics from IIT-Kharagpur/ Applied Statistics & Informatics from IIT-Bombay with a minimum of 55% marks or equivalent grade in aggregate of all semesters / years.
OR
(b.) Master’s Degree in Mathematics with a minimum of 55% marks or an equivalent grade in aggregate of all semesters / years and one year post graduate diploma in Statistics or related subjects from an Institute of repute.
OR
(c.) M. Stat. Degree of Indian Statistical Institute with a minimum of 55% marks in aggregate of all semesters / years.
OR
(d.) Post Graduate Diploma in Business Analytics (PGDBA) jointly offered by ISI Kolkata, IIT Kharagpur and IIM Calcutta with a minimum of 55% marks or equivalent grade in aggregate of all semesters/years.

Age Limit –

Candidates are required to be aged between 21 years and 30 years (both age included) to apply for RBI Grade B exam 2022. For candidates possessing M.Phil. and Ph.D. qualifications, the upper age limit will be 32 and 34 years respectively.

Age Relaxation –

CategoryAge relaxation
SC/ST5 years
OBC3 years
Physically Handicapped10 years
PH + OBC13 years
PH + SC/ST15 years

RBI Grade B Selection Process –

RBI Grade B 2022 Exam is conducted in three phases, while the Prelims examination is Objective in nature while the Mains examination would comprise of the objective as well as descriptive test

  1. Phase-I exam
  2. Phase-II exam and
  3. Interview process

Prelims Exam Pattern –

The prelims exam of RBI Grade-B Officer 2022 comprises a single Paper for 200 marks. A total time of 120 minutes will be given for answering. However, separate time will be allotted for each test.

SNoSection AskedNo. of QuestionsMaximum Marks
1.General Awareness5050
2.Quantitative Aptitude5050
3.English Language5050
4.Reasoning5050

Interview –

Candidates will be shortlisted for the interview, based on aggregate marks obtained in Paper-I, Paper-II and Paper-III of Phase II exam. Interview Process will carry 50 marks.
